码迷,mamicode.com
首页 >  
搜索关键字:表锁    ( 479个结果
MySQL InnoDB与MyISAM存储引擎差异
前言: 之前简单介绍过 MySQL 常用的存储引擎,今天对两个主流的存储简单分析下差异,书上没有参考的笔试题解答注解; 差异: MyISAM 只支持表锁,不支持事务,表损坏率较高。较老的存储引擎。 它分为2种类型的文件:以 MYD 作为后缀名的数据文件和以 MYI 作为后缀名的索引文件。 MyISA ...
分类:数据库   时间:2017-08-02 15:01:56    阅读次数:171
悲观锁和乐观锁
悲观锁(Pessimistic Lock), 顾名思义,就是很悲观,每次去拿数据的时候都认为别人会修改,所以每次在拿数据的时候都会上锁,这样别人想拿这个数据就会block直到它拿到锁。传统的关系型数据库里边就用到了很多这种锁机制,比如行锁,表锁等,读锁,写锁等,都是在做操作之前先上锁。 乐观锁(Op ...
分类:其他好文   时间:2017-08-01 16:30:53    阅读次数:94
SQLServer+.net 事务锁表问题
最近操作Sqlserver遇到一个锁表问题。找了好久才搞明白原因和解决办法。 故障现象: 每次启动事务后,执行了删除或者修改操作以后,再执行查询操作就锁表。 解决过程: 1:最初以为SQLServer进行删除和修改操作后是表锁定机制,造成无法查询,结果不是。 2:搜索查询锁表的SQL,分析了一下锁表 ...
分类:数据库   时间:2017-07-21 01:19:55    阅读次数:193
python文件操作:换行问题
假设一个文件已经存在,内容如下: mr mr ms ms ex ex 现在要给这个文件中的mr一行加入一个标志,代表锁定状态,即期望加上此标志的内容如下: mr mr Lock ms ms ex ex 使用如下代码对文件进行重写: 写完以后文件却变成了 mr mr Lock ms ms ex ex ...
分类:编程语言   时间:2017-07-16 10:03:00    阅读次数:245
mysql查看锁表解锁
-- 查看那些表锁到了 show OPEN TABLES where In_use > 0; -- 查看进程号 show processlist; -- 删除进程 kill 1085850; ...
分类:数据库   时间:2017-07-12 11:06:46    阅读次数:187
MyISAM表锁
MySQL的锁机制比较简单,其最显著的特点是不同的存储引擎支持不同的锁机制。 MyISAM和MEMORY存储引擎采用的是表级锁(table-level locking)。 BDB 存储引擎采用的是页面锁(page-level locking),但也支持表级锁。 InnoDB存储引擎既支持行级锁(ro ...
分类:其他好文   时间:2017-07-11 11:12:10    阅读次数:165
乐观锁和悲观锁
悲观锁:修改数据之前先对该记录加锁,该期间别的线程无法修改该记录,等提交之后其他线程才可以获得锁,例如:数据库行锁,表锁,写锁,都是悲观锁 乐观锁:每次去获取数据不会加锁,但是更新记录的时候会判断一下当前记录是否和自己读取的是否一致,不一致重新读取,再更新,大都是通过版本号判断当前记录和自己读取的记 ...
分类:其他好文   时间:2017-07-05 13:35:15    阅读次数:148
数据库优化
7.1.1. MySQL设计局限与折衷 当使用MyISAM存储引擎时,MySQL使用极快速的表锁定,以便允许多次读或一次写。使用该存储引擎的最大问题出现在同一个表中进行混合稳定数据流更新与慢速选择。如果这只是某些表的问题,你可以使用另一个存储引擎。 MySQL可以使用事务表和非事务表。为了更容易地让 ...
分类:数据库   时间:2017-06-25 17:46:22    阅读次数:216
MySQL高级-锁机制
一、概述 1、定义 2、锁的分类 ①从对数据操作的类型(读\写)分 读锁(共享锁):针对同一份数据,多个读操作可以同时进行而不会互相影响。 写锁(排它锁):当前写操作没有完成前,它会阻断其他写锁和读锁。 ②从对数据操作的粒度分 表锁 行锁 二、三锁 1、表锁(偏读) 特点:偏向MyISM存储引擎,开 ...
分类:数据库   时间:2017-06-25 16:57:24    阅读次数:215
【转】乐观锁和悲观锁的区别
悲观锁(Pessimistic Lock), 顾名思义,就是很悲观,每次去拿数据的时候都认为别人会修改,所以每次在拿数据的时候都会上锁,这样别人想拿这个数据就会block直到它拿到锁。传统的关系型数据库里边就用到了很多这种锁机制,比如行锁,表锁等,读锁,写锁等,都是在做操作之前先上锁。 乐观锁(Op ...
分类:其他好文   时间:2017-06-21 09:41:54    阅读次数:162
479条   上一页 1 ... 27 28 29 30 31 ... 48 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!